My first card is made with Teeny Stego and the Something to Roar About sentiment. I colored him very simply with Copics and added some grass under him to "ground" him. I inked up the sentiment with Not Quite Navy ink and then cleaned off the word roar (with my thumb...!) and used a marker to ink that word. I didn't want to add a bow since this is a "boy" card, but I couldn't help adding some stitching and brads. :-)

My next project is with Mr. Spike. Isn't he adorable??? He *absolutely* reminds me of the dog on Bugs Bunny and he definitely makes me smile! I decided to alter a piano practice book for my niece. (Aren't I a nice piano teacher??? LOL!) It's much more fun to practice when the book is cute!!

I stamped Spike on Kraft paper and colored him with prismacolors. If you look closely in the next picture, you'll see that there is no dp on this project. I used my white gel pen for the polka dots on the top and I simply drew vertical lines with a ruler for the bottom. Voila! Instant dp!!
